Description:

Pilkey plays with words and pictures, providing great entertainment. The story is immediately engaging—two fourth-grade boys who write comic books and love to pull pranks find themselves in big trouble. Mean Mr. Krupp, their principal, videotapes George and Harold setting up their stunts and threatens to expose them. The boys’ luck changes when they send for a 3-D Hypno-Ring and hypnotize Krupp, turning him into Captain Underpants, their own superhero creation. Later, Pilkey includes several pages of flip-o-ramas that animate the action. The simple black-and-white illustrations on every page furnish comic-strip appeal. The cover features Captain Underpants, resplendent in white briefs, on top of a tall building. This book will fly off the shelves.

About The Author

Dav Pilkey, born in 1966, is an American author and illustrator. He also goes by the pen names, George Beard and Harold Hutchins. Pilkey has written and illustrated many award-winning children’s books. Some of his works include The Adventures Of Ook And Gluk, Captain Underpants And The Revolting Revenge Of The Radioactive Robo-Boxers, and Kung-Fu Cavemen From The Future. Pilkey was born in Cleveland, Ohio, and won a national competition for his first book, World War Won, while in school. He moved to Seattle in 1996, and started writing. He is the winner of the California Young Reader Medal. Pilkey lives near Pacific Northwest, but divides his time between Minami Izu, Japan and Bainbridge Island, WA.
